    <title>1972 (8) TMI 40 - GUJARAT High Court</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=8994</link>
    <description>A return filed after the time allowed under section 139(1) or section 139(2), though within the extended period under section 139(4), does not count as timely for penalty purposes under section 271(1)(a). The court read the language of section 271(1)(a) in its ordinary sense and held that the saving facility in section 139(4) only permits a valid belated return before assessment; it does not remove the earlier default or extend the original time limit. The decision in Kulu Valley Transport Co. was confined to its own facts and did not govern this penalty issue, so the question was answered in favour of the Revenue.</description>
